How to get there

How to Reach Wadebridge, United Kingdom

Wadebridge is a charming town located in the county of Cornwall, United Kingdom. It is well-connected and can be easily reached by various modes of transportation. Here are some ways to reach Wadebridge:

By Air:

The nearest international airport to Wadebridge is Newquay Cornwall Airport, which is approximately 11 miles away. From the airport, you can hire a taxi or take a bus to reach Wadebridge. Several airlines operate flights to and from Newquay, providing convenient access to the town.

By Train:

Wadebridge does not have a train station of its own. However, the nearby Bodmin Parkway Railway Station is well-connected to major cities in the United Kingdom. From the station, you can take a taxi or a bus to reach Wadebridge, which is approximately 7 miles away.

By Bus:

Wadebridge is easily accessible by bus from various locations in Cornwall. National Express operates regular bus services to Wadebridge from cities like London, Bristol, and Plymouth. Additionally, local bus services connect Wadebridge to nearby towns and villages, making it a convenient option for travel.

By Car:

If you prefer to drive, Wadebridge is easily reachable via the A39 road, which passes through the town. The A39 connects Wadebridge to major cities and towns in Cornwall, making it a convenient option for those traveling by car. There are ample parking facilities available in and around Wadebridge.

By Bicycle:

For the adventurous and eco-conscious travelers, cycling to Wadebridge is a great option. The town is well-connected to the National Cycle Network, allowing cyclists to enjoy scenic routes while reaching their destination. Wadebridge also offers bicycle rental services for visitors who wish to explore the town on two wheels.

Getting to know Wadebridge

Wadebridge is a charming town located in the county of Cornwall, United Kingdom. Situated on the banks of the River Camel, it is surrounded by picturesque countryside and is a popular destination for tourists and locals alike.

One of the main attractions in Wadebridge is the historic bridge that spans the River Camel. Built in the 15th century, the bridge is a testament to the town's rich history and is a popular spot for visitors to take in the beautiful views of the river and the surrounding countryside.

In addition to its natural beauty, Wadebridge is also known for its vibrant town center. The streets are lined with independent shops, cafes, and restaurants, offering a wide range of options for shopping and dining. The town also hosts a regular farmers market, where visitors can sample and purchase local produce and crafts.

For outdoor enthusiasts, Wadebridge is an ideal base for exploring the nearby Camel Trail. This scenic trail follows the route of an old railway line and is perfect for walking or cycling. The trail takes you through stunning countryside and picturesque villages, offering a unique way to experience the beauty of the area.
